Rand Capital Corporation (NASDAQ: RAND) announced the election of Cari Jaroslawsky to its Board of Directors, succeeding Allen F. Grum, whose term expired. With this appointment, the board now consists of five members, four of whom are independent. Robert M. Zak, Chair of the Board, highlighted Jaroslawsky's extensive operations and finance expertise as beneficial for the company's growth and investment initiatives. Jaroslawsky has over 25 years of experience in aerospace engineering and finance, currently serving at Eaton (NYSE: ETN) and previously as CFO at Servotronics.
Rand Capital Corporation (Nasdaq: RAND) reported a 31% increase in total investment income, achieving $4.1 million for 2021. The fourth quarter saw income rise by 17% to $1.2 million. Net asset value per share rose to $23.54, up 32% year-over-year. In 2021, they declared total dividends of $0.44 per share and announced a 50% increase in the first quarter 2022 dividend to $0.15 per share. Total investments for the year reached $19.7 million. Rand repaid $11 million in SBA obligations in Q4, enhancing financial flexibility.

Rand Capital Corporation (NASDAQ: RAND) has declared a regular quarterly cash dividend of $0.15 per share, an increase of $0.05 from the previous year. The dividend will be paid on or about March 28, 2022, to shareholders on record by March 14, 2022. This increase reflects the company's strategic shift towards more income-producing investments, as noted by CEO Daniel P. Penberthy. The Board of Directors' decisions on dividends will depend on various factors including taxable income and other financial metrics.
Rand Capital Corporation (NASDAQ: RAND) announced a quarterly dividend of $0.10 per share and a supplemental dividend of $0.04 per share, totaling $0.14. The dividends will be distributed on or about December 31, 2021, to shareholders of record as of December 20, 2021. This payment reflects additional taxable income from previous years, offset by increased expenses from the surrender of its SBIC license. Future dividends remain at the Board's discretion, based on taxable income estimates which may differ from net income.
Rand Capital Corporation (NASDAQ: RAND) reported a 37% increase in total investment income for Q3 2021, reaching $1.0 million. The net asset value (NAV) per share rose 4% to $23.31. The company made a new investment of $3.8 million in DSD Operating, while also exiting its investment in Centivo Corporation with a recognized gain of $1.6 million. Cash and cash equivalents totaled $13.3 million, representing 22.1% of net assets. In efforts to simplify operations, Rand repaid $11 million of SBA obligations and plans to surrender its SBIC license.
Rand Capital Corporation (Nasdaq: RAND) announced the retirement of President and CEO Allen F. “Pete” Grum, effective December 1, 2021. He will transition to Vice Chair of the Board. Daniel P. Penberthy, currently the Executive Vice President and CFO, has been appointed as the new President and CEO. Margaret Brechtel has been promoted to Executive Vice President and CFO. Additionally, Robert M. Zak will replace Erland “Erkie” Kailbourne as Chair of the Board. The company emphasizes its commitment to transforming its operations and enhancing shareholder value.

Rand Capital Corporation (NASDAQ: RAND) announced the sale of all its equity holdings in Centivo Corporation, netting gross proceeds of approximately $2.4 million. This transaction, which generated an estimated gain of $1.6 million, aligns with Rand's strategy to exit equity investments and reinvest in income-generating assets. The holdings in Centivo represented 2.4% of Rand's net assets as of June 30, 2021. The company continues to focus on maximizing total returns for its shareholders by investing in lower middle-market companies.
